Malicious code in actions-broker (RubyGems)
The RubyGems package 'actions-broker' version 99.99.99 has been identified as malicious by the OpenSSF Package Analysis project. The package executes one or more commands associated with malicious behavior. No official patch or remediation guidance is provided. There is no evidence of known exploits in the wild at this time.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
The 'actions-broker' RubyGems package at version 99.99.99 is flagged as malicious due to its execution of commands linked to malicious activity. This determination comes from the OpenSSF Package Analysis project and is cataloged under MAL-2025-46890. No further technical details or CVSS scoring are available, and no vendor advisory or patch information is provided.
Potential Impact
Use of the 'actions-broker' package version 99.99.99 may result in execution of malicious commands, potentially compromising the security of systems that incorporate this package. The exact impact is not detailed, and no known exploits have been reported.
Mitigation Recommendations
Avoid using the 'actions-broker' package version 99.99.99. Since no patch or remediation is available, remove or replace this package with a trusted alternative. Monitor for updates from the package maintainers or security advisories for any future fixes.
